EDA meeting draws largest attendance in memory

2023-04-20 - Columbia, KY - Photo by Linda Waggener, ColumbiaMagazine.com
The April meeting of the Columbia Adair Economic Development Authority (EDA) had the largest attendance in memory. The Board went into executive session which lasted approximately two hours. They insisted no motions were made as a result of it. Pictured from left, standing, are: Kinzie Rowe, Chester Taylor, Doyle Lloyd, Bobby Morrison and Larry Walker. Seated are Heather Spoon and Mark Dykes. Board member Roger Meadows had to leave before the picture was made.

Walker appointed to Board of EDA

2023-04-20 - Columbia, KY - Photo by Linda Waggener, ColumbiaMagazine.com
Larry Walker, at left, was appointed by the City Council as Board Member to fill the vacancy of Ann Martin. Chairman Bobby Morrison noted that Walker was part of the original group that organized the Columbia Adair County EDA, then the Industrial Authority, so he is coming back home. Also pictured are Kinzie Rowe, center, and Chester Taylor at right.

Update on grant applications for GRCP

2023-04-20 - Columbia, KY - Photo by Linda Waggener, ColumbiaMagazine.com
Heather Spoon, center, EDA Marketing Director, gave a report on grant applications. The grant for a build ready pad at the Green River Commerce Park is progressing into the second phase - Adair EDA was selected as one of 54 applicants in phase one. She said she has also been encouraged by state EDA leaders to apply for a larger upcoming grant. At left is Roger Meadows, treasurer, and at right is Mark Dykes, vice chair.
